Learn more about Penrith

Nestled at the gateway to the Lake District, Penrith offers ancient castle ruins and the mysterious King Arthur's Round Table monument. Explore the red sandstone buildings of the historic town centre or hike nearby Beacon Hill for panoramic views of the Eden Valley.

Best time to go to Penrith

The best time to visit Penrith can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Penrith fal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Penrith fal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

How can I get around Penrith?
If you want to travel outside the area, hop on a train from Penrith Station, Langwathby Station or Lazonby & Kirkoswald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Penrith for your journey.
What's the seasonal weather in Penrith?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 11°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 1°C. Average annual precipitation for Penrith is 1195 mm.
